Re: Okay getting bored: Show me your ride....the one with an engine! [jackmott] [ In reply to ]
Quote | Reply
  • Terrible torque steer (came from a Twin Turbo AWD car)
  • Terrible Snow Traction (both on the OE tires and the new Bridgestones - it is a weight thing)
  • Terrible oil usage (2qts every oil change of Mobil1 0-40)
  • Seats tear up fast on drivers bolster
  • Terrible design on e-brake lever that wears from the arm wrest
  • Terrible cup holders (far too close for anything but two cans of soda)
  • Terrible place for 12v jack (under arm wrest)
  • Rear seats do not fold flat
  • Terrible rear seat cup holders
  • Sunshades on roof are worthless
  • Wheel bearings are shit (3 gone in warranty period - one post warranty)
  • Wheels peel and flake "clear coat" with out scratches
  • Climate Control is flaky on passenger side (in three I have driven - Ice air on passenger feet in the winter despite the settings)
  • DSG cant handle ANY mods ( I did not mod my car, but those I know that have been blew up their DSG)

I owned a 1969 MGB years ago. The pre emission control ones with the chrome bumpers and twin SU carbs are the ones you want. The later rubber bumper ones with the single carb and elevated front end just don't cut it. The front SCCA racer style spoiler you've added is a nice after market touch.

I also had a fatted out 1970 MG Midget with a hotted up 1275cc engine and suspension mods. That car was the ultimate sleeper.
